Sonos speakers are really really good and versatile. You can use them many ways, not just for surround sound. However, their surround sound set up is quite pricey and they are not 100% wireless, you need to run power to them. I run a sound bar, not sonos, and I swear it's just as good as having surround sound speakers. Can hear all kinds of movie sounds all over the room.

I was originally concerned about sound quality loss with the wireless, but I gave it a try in the store and while its a limited test, they really did rock, plus all of the reviews were great on line and people I've talked to about them. We have hardwood floors and wiring the house would involve me having to crawl around the hot ass attic or pay someone to do it for me. The soundbar is basically the receiver for the other components; woofer and surround speakers. Starting off with 2 Play 3's and they have great mid to high range. ------------------------- Specializing in sarcasm and condescending rhetoric since 1971. |

Got everything set up and I couldn't be happier with how it sounds. The wood floors really help too I think. I'll probably end up getting a couple more speakers for the master bedroom and the porch, just for when I play music. I can bluetooth pretty much any of my music straight to the system; spotify, Iheartradio, amazon music and even the music on my phone.
Tuning the speakers to the room was pretty cool. It used the speaker on my phone to listen as it calibrated itself. I've heard B&O and newer Harmon Kardon have similar functions, but I've never actually seen it done before. I returned the Polk system. Their software for the wi-fi speaker network isn't working well. I had their soundbar and two wireless speakers that can all be used together for 5.1 dolby. But, adding them as surrounds took about 20 mins. Then, all hell breaks loose taking them out of the "speaker group" to use them separately. The sound from their S6 speakers was very nice in my bedroom though.
I ordered a Pioneer receiver and found a deal on a complete Bowers and Wilkins speaker group on Craig's. The pioneer is wi-fit too, and can add network speakers later. |
